The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of John T Causonthue, born in 1832 in Newington, Surrey, consisted of 6 members. John T was the head of the household, married to Annie Causonthue, born in 1833 in Bristol, Gloucestershire, England. They had 1 child; Andrew P, born 1861 in Cheltenham, Gloucestershire, England.
During the period, also present in the household were John T's Servant, Jane (born 1856 in Brixworth, Northamptonshire, England), John T's Boarder, Percy (born 1851 in Stafford, Staffordshire, England) and John T's Boarder, John (born 1857 in Stafford, Staffordshire, England).
